Mycotoxin that inhibits DNA synthesis. Induces sister chromatid exchanges in bone marrow cells of mice. Causes necrosis.
ST exerts a marked influence on gastric mucus and gland cells, showing dominant gastritis, erosion events, polyps, and intestinal metaplasia in these animals.1 Long-term administration of the fungus toxin, sterigmatocystin, induces intestinal metaplasia and increases the proliferative activity of PCNA, p53, and MDM2 in the gastric mucosa of aged Mongolian gerbils. M Kusunoki, J Misumi, et al, Jul 2011; 16(4): 224-31.

| Product Number | S-1094 |
| CAS # | 10048-13-2 |
| Appearance | Yellow Powder |
| Melting Point | 245°C |
| Purity | Purity: >98% |
| Storage Temp | -20°C |
